Looks like "Tinker" will be the Next Class

Tinker, Engineer, Technician, Whatever you wanna call it.
Everything looks to me Like Tinker will be the Next class:

  • Datamined Tinker Abilities from BFA. (With Level Requirements and Cooldowns)
  • Island Expedition Teams showing off 3 specializations.
  • Several Available races with allied races.
  • Still Need 1 More Mail User
  • Only 2 Specs of 1 class use ranged weapons.
  • New Tutorial Zone, Exiles Reach, Has a Tinker Character ready to go.
  • No Lore Stretching or Mental Gymnastics required. Already PART of WoW.
  • Even has a Hero Unit in WarCraft 3 to steal from like DK, DH, and Monk Did.

It seems like more and more people realize that Tinker is likely to be the next class. The Hoax leak at the end of BFA claimed a Tinker Class was coming, so does World of WarCraft Awakening, though I think that’s fake as well.
It just goes to show that the people who make these leaks think that Tinker is a “Believable” concept for a class.

We Even got that April Fools joke expansion for Undermine, Also had a Tinker Class.

Seems to me like it’s innevitable at this point. Like Demon Hunters. Tinkers for 10.0!

Not at all? Since when do Classes Invalidate professions?
Death Knights got their own unique enchants, and we still have enchanters.

Rogues have poisons, and Alchemists have Blade Oils!

Classes and Professions overlapping isn’t a problem, nor will it ever be a problem.
